Electrophosphorescence from polythiophene blends light-emitting diodes

Abstract [en]
Electrophosphorescence has been observed in phosphorescent blend polythiophene LEDs with poly(3-methyl-4-octyl-thiophene) (PMOT) as host, bis (2-phenylbenzothiazole) iridium acetylacetonate (BTIr) as the guest. Investigation of photoluminescence and quantum yields shows that energy transfer exists in the host-guest system and depends on guest concentration. Electroluminescence indicates that charge trapping effect also contributes to the formation of exciton at phosphorescent centers.
